Output 58a857dff4b36e7ec9462fb128838b11bf81b32034063f9f1a0b59051997a883:2

value
35147210
script pubkey
OP_0 OP_PUSHBYTES_20 d5b111a036ad79de4a42c21094bcd3cffad66731
address
ltc1q6kc3rgpk44uaujjzcggff0xneladvee3mm0pu8
transaction
58a857dff4b36e7ec9462fb128838b11bf81b32034063f9f1a0b59051997a883
spent
true